Chapter 28

Manga ChapterCh. 28

The Human Cavalry Battle opens with every team in the stadium hunting one boy and his ten million points. Izuku survives the first wave, Katsuki loses everything to a rival class, and Shoto Todoroki finally announces what he came for.

Arc: U.A. Sports Festival
Issue: 10, 2015
Pages: 19
Volume: 4
Release Date: January 26, 2015
Anime Episode: Episode 17
Chapter Title: Strats, Strats, Strats
Japanese Title: 策策策

Summary

Shoto briefs his riders, Tenya, Denki and Momo, on formation and assignments before the round starts. Asked whether he plans to mix ice and fire to sell feints, he shuts the idea down: the fire half stays unused in a fight, period.

The whistle blows and the arena converges on Team Midoriya. Team Hagakure and Team Tetsutetsu strike first, and Izuku slips clear on a combination of Mei's Hover Boots, Zero Gravity from Ochaco and Fumikage's Dark Shadow. Tetsutetsu comes again and Dark Shadow walls him off. Team Mineta joins the pile and forces a retreat, then Katsuki dives in for Izuku personally, only for his Explosion to be swallowed by Dark Shadow.

Katsuki's own unit, Eijiro, Hanta and Mina, catches up, and Hanta's tape hauls him back into position. In that instant a Class 1-B student, Neito, lifts the headband right off him. Neito explains the trick: his class spent the Obstacle Race studying Class 1-A and built the cavalry round on what they saw. He then twists the knife by pitying Katsuki for being the villain's hostage year after year. Katsuki, incandescent, tells Eijiro the order has changed; Neito comes first, Izuku second.

Izuku tells his team the pressure should ease off now. Team Todoroki arrives to prove him wrong, with Shoto stating plainly that the ten million points are his.

Notes

Nineteen pages, published in Weekly Shonen Jump issue 10 of 2015 and collected in volume 4 as part of the U.A. Sports Festival arc. Shoto Todoroki, Tenya Ida, Momo Yaoyorozu and Denki Kaminari appear on the cover, and Episode 17 adapts the chapter.

The setting is the Sports Festival Stadium at U.A. High School in Musutafu, Japan. Explosive Speed is the only named super move on display.

Pony Tsunotori is referenced by name here, and the Sludge Villain appears in a mention as Katsuki's history with hostage situations is thrown back at him.
